Best Ways to Reach CALSTART's Hiring Team

Email

Email is the most effective channel for reaching CALSTART recruiters and HR professionals. With 6 verified email contacts on staff, you can directly reach decision-makers without relying on LinkedIn messaging or application portals. Craft a professional, personalized email that demonstrates your knowledge of CALSTART and explains why you're interested in the organization.

  • Use a clear, professional subject line that includes the role title and your name (e.g., 'Senior Web Developer Application - [Your Name]')
  • Address the email to a specific recruiter or HR professional by name; avoid generic 'To Whom It May Concern' greetings
  • Keep your email concise (under 150 words) and include a link to your resume or portfolio—don't paste your entire background in the email body
  • Reference a specific CALSTART initiative or recent project to show you've done your research
  • Include a clear call-to-action, such as 'I'd welcome the opportunity to discuss how my experience aligns with CALSTART's mission'

Do's for Contacting CALSTART

  • Do research CALSTART's specific initiatives and recent projects before reaching out—mention something concrete that demonstrates genuine interest in their mission
  • Do personalize every email to a specific recruiter or HR professional by name; CALSTART's small team appreciates direct, targeted outreach
  • Do lead with how your skills and experience support CALSTART's mission of advancing clean transportation and zero-emission vehicles
  • Do keep your initial email brief and professional, with a clear link to your full resume or portfolio—respect their time
  • Do follow up after 2-3 weeks if you haven't heard back; CALSTART's selective hiring means they're managing multiple priorities
  • Do highlight any experience with mission-driven organizations, sustainability, policy advocacy, or automotive industry work

Don'ts to Avoid

  • Don't send generic mass emails to multiple CALSTART contacts simultaneously—they communicate internally and will notice lack of specificity
  • Don't rely solely on LinkedIn messaging; email is the established and most effective channel for reaching CALSTART recruiters
  • Don't apply for multiple CALSTART positions without customizing your application for each role—with selective hiring, they notice and it hurts your credibility
  • Don't mention salary expectations or demands in your initial outreach; CALSTART is mission-driven and compensation discussions come later
  • Don't contact CALSTART recruiters repeatedly in short timeframes; patience is important in their selective hiring process

How can I stand out when reaching out to CALSTART recruiters?

CALSTART receives outreach from many candidates interested in clean transportation and sustainability work. To stand out, demonstrate deep knowledge of CALSTART's specific mission, recent projects, and industry landscape. Reference a particular initiative or report in your email, explain why it matters to you, and connect it to your experience. Show that you understand the challenges CALSTART is working to solve and how your skills directly address those challenges. Avoid generic sustainability language—be specific about CALSTART's work and why you want to contribute to it. A recruiter receives dozens of emails; the ones that mention specific projects and demonstrate genuine research get responses.

Should I contact multiple recruiters at CALSTART, or focus on one?

Focus on identifying and contacting the most relevant recruiter for your target role or department. CALSTART's small HR team (4 people) means they communicate internally and coordinate on hiring. Contacting multiple recruiters with similar messages will likely backfire, as they'll see duplicate outreach and question your professionalism. Instead, research which recruiter oversees hiring for your area of interest, send one thoughtful, personalized email, and wait for a response. If you don't hear back after 3 weeks, a single follow-up is appropriate. Quality and specificity matter far more than volume when reaching out to CALSTART.
